Community Relations Representative ($24.38 - $30.29)
Position Summary:
Weekends required
Assists the Community Manager and Assistant Manager with on-site operations of a single community, multiple communities, or neighborhood (“operating unit”). Serves as the first point of contact for resident interactions on-site. Assists with all inquiries including resident requests, move-in/outs, transfers, renewals, evictions and other resident-related items. Community Relations Representatives responsible for multiple communities will handle an increased level of complexity with individual and consolidated operations of varying locations and product types.
Skills required for Customer Relations Representatives include but are not limited to: time-management, effective verbal and written communication, and organization.
Job Duties:
- Creates a well-organized, customer service-focused culture for residents, prospects, vendors, and employees; ensures that resident and corporate requests and concerns are promptly responded to and resolved; takes a proactive approach for all key customer touch points.
- Assists in the training, onboarding, and development of new team members. Contributes to a culture of excellence, good time management practices, and continuous learning. Embraces and promotes new technology; finds efficiencies by maximizing its utilization.
- Positively contributes to the financial performance of the operating unit.
- Supports the team to meet key metrics for the operating unit. Monitors and communicates key Notice to Vacate findings and follow up on customer satisfaction surveys and social media posts as needed.
- Assists with daily operations of the operating unit’s resident services office which may include sales, processing move-in/outs, transfers, renewals, Final Account Statements, lease agreements, delinquency, and applications as needed and in accordance with Company policies and procedures.
- Timely and appropriately documents and communicates important operating unit information to management, and resident concerns, requests, and resolutions into appropriate software systems.
- Walks all communities in the operating unit and works with the team to ensure that the condition and quality meet Irvine Company standards at all times.
- Other duties as assigned.
Variances in responsibilities may exist by operating unit.
